A parallel plate capacitor has plate area 100m² and plate separation of 10m. The space between the plates is filled up to a thickness 5m with material of dielectric constant of 10. The resultant capacitance of the system is 'x' pF.
The value of ε? = 8.85 × 10?¹² F.m?¹
The value of 'x' to the nearest integer is ----------.

1/C = 5/ (ε? × 100) + 5/ (10ε? × 100)
⇒ C = (ε? × 1000) / 55 = (8.85 × 10? ¹² × 1000) / 55 = 1.61 × 10? ¹? F = 161 pF

It is the farad (F). The name came from Michael Faraday. SI Unit of Capacitance means the ability of a system to store an electric charge. One farad is the capacitance of a device that needs one coulomb of charge to provide one volt potential difference across it. Mathematically, it is represented by - 1 Farad = 1 Coulomb/Volt.
